Learning Targets:

✳ I can use and describe rigid motions to decide if two figures are congruent (MGSE9-12.G.CO.6)

✳ I can use the definition of congruence to show that two triangles are congruent if and only if corresponding pairs of sides and corresponding pairs of angles are congruent. (MGSE9-12.G.CO.7)

✳ I can explain how the criteria for triangle congruence (SSS, SAS, ASA, AAS, and HL) follow from the definition of congruence in terms of rigid motions. (MGSE9-12.G.CO.8)
